Notice Title
RFQ for Provision of a Daily Attendance & Attainment Monitoring inc. a Personal Education Plan System
Notice Description
Halton Borough Council has a statutory duty to ensure that it knows if each child in its care has arrived in school, has stayed in school, and has therefore been safe. It also has a duty to improve educational outcomes for all children in its care and to monitor their progress and attainment regularly through the completion of a termly Personal Education Plan. This duty is in place from the day a child or young person enters care to the day they leave. In addition to these duties, Halton Borough Council undertakes to ensure that it understands the attendance of every child with an EHCP placed within other Local Authority schools or who are in independent or non-maintained provision. In order to support Halton Borough Council to carry out its duties and requirements, we wish to commission a system, which provides: 1. A daily report on the school attendance of children/young people in the care of Halton, regardless of where they are educated, or who have an EHCP and are in other local authority schools or independent or non-maintained provision. The supplier must have the ability to differentiate this data, which can be shared with key professionals including social workers and staff in the Virtual School, Education Welfare Team, SEN Team and Placements Team. This is an Essential requirement. 2. Termly progress data for all children in care to Halton Borough Council regardless of where they are educated. This is an Essential requirement. 3. An electronic Personal Education Plan system that can be personalised to meet Halton Borough Council's needs that is completed on a termly basis for all children in care from nursery through to the end of their post 16 education. This is a Desirable requirement
